Spotlight on the Imperial KK0067-A Cement & Mortar Cartridge
The star of this category, the Imperial KK0067-A, comes in a convenient 10.3 oz cartridge that's perfect for caulking guns. Its gray color blends naturally with most brickwork, providing an aesthetic match while ensuring a powerful bond. This mortar cures quickly, even in damp conditions, and offers excellent flexibility to accommodate minor structural shifts without compromising integrity. Ideal for small to medium projects, it minimizes waste and cleanup compared to traditional bucket mixes.

Common Use Cases for Imperial Brick Mortars
Imperial products excel in a variety of scenarios. Use the KK0067-A for repairing cracked mortar joints in historic brick buildings, sealing gaps in chimneys, or laying new bricks in patios and retaining walls. Homeowners tackling garden walls or fireplace restorations appreciate the cartridge's portability, while contractors value its reliability on job sites.
